NYC Council Speaker demands investigation into NYPD social media conduct

New York City Council Speaker Adrienne Adams is demanding an independent probe into the NYPD’s use of social media, after a high-ranking police official said a sitting Council member “hates our city.”

In a statement announcing her request Friday evening, Speaker Adams accused police of “dangerous” and “unethical” behavior on social media, days after Chief of Patrol John Chell railed against Council Member Tiffany Cabán in a post from his departmental account on X.

Cabán had criticized the arrests of pro-Palestinian protesters at Columbia University and City College this week. Chell said in a post Wednesday that “this is coming from a person who hates our city” and urged the public to get “involved.” Police said the post was "accidentally deleted" and Chell re-posted the message Thursday night.
